What is a Stainless Steel Plate?


Stainless steel plate is a type of metal sheet made from a steel alloy with a high chromium concentration. Chromium is added to steel to provide it excellent corrosion and stain resistance, a long lifespan, and incredible tensile strength. Stainless steel plates are available in a variety of grades, each with its own distinct features and applications. They are extensively utilised in the construction of structures, chemical tanks, medical gadgets, and food processing equipment, to mention a few. Uses of Stainless Steel Plate in Construction


Because of their unique features and benefits, stainless steel plates have a wide range of uses in building. Here are some examples of popular applications for stainless steel plates in the building industry:


Structural Components: Stainless steel plates are utilised in building projects for structural purposes. They are useful for load-bearing applications such as beams, columns, and trusses due to their strength, endurance, and corrosion resistance.


Facades and Cladding: Stainless steel plates can be utilised as building facade cladding. They have an appealing look and require little upkeep. Stainless steel plates can be treated in a variety of textures and colours, adding to the overall visual attractiveness of the structure.


Roofs and Roofing Components: Stainless steel plates are utilised in both residential and commercial roofing applications. They are lightweight, resilient, and corrosion-resistant, making them ideal for shielding the structure from inclement weather.


Handrails and Balustrades: Stainless steel plates are often utilised in the construction of handrails and balustrades. They provide a sturdy and long-lasting railing system while adding a modern and elegant touch to staircases, balconies, and walkways.


Decorative Applications: Decorative stainless steel plates are utilised in building projects. They can be used as wall panels, lift cladding, ornamental screens and signs in interior design. The shiny surface of stainless steel may provide a visually attractive and modern appearance.
